Output d02657e5b5241f7b10b1df0c9bb3db478ded0fff52c699d904a61b8078ed6f4c:0

value
33649131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5c7d32e80c02a16df707b608b85a1c0b3616a58 OP_EQUAL
address
3Ndz3YzLgc8LbihyZDLCwEkbVBkoGW33kA
transaction
d02657e5b5241f7b10b1df0c9bb3db478ded0fff52c699d904a61b8078ed6f4c
confirmations
389711
spent
true